AMD Zen 2 CVE-2026-46174: Operation Cache Microarchitecture Flaw Enables Kernel Privilege Escalation
AMD published Security Bulletin AMD-SB-7052 on 28 May for CVE-2026-46174, a microarchitectural flaw in Zen 2 processor operation caches. A local attacker can exploit timing characteristics of the op-cache to execute code with kernel privileges from a userspace context. PI firmware updates are required; the Xen Project also issued XSA-490 for virtualisation platform impacts.

AMD Discloses Elevation of Privilege Vulnerability in Zen 2 Micro-Op Cache — Microcode and Firmware Updates Required
AMD has disclosed an elevation-of-privilege vulnerability in the micro-op cache of Zen 2 processors, where a low-privileged process can exploit speculative execution behaviour to access privileged memory content. Full remediation requires microcode updates delivered via OEM BIOS firmware. Zen 3 and later generations are not affected. Dell PowerEdge EPYC Rome servers and AMD EPYC Rome cloud instances require priority attention.
